Central Huron Council Receives United Way Funding Request

The campaign chair for the United Way of Perth-Huron made a unique request to Central Huron council Monday night.

Andrew Williams says the campaign is a little behind its normal pace at this point, so he's asking each municipal council to support the United Way by donating $0.50 for each resident in that municipality.  He's also asking county council to match that, bringing the total to $1 for each resident in the county.

Williams says by doing that, municipal leaders would be showing residents the campaign deserves their support.

The funding request was referred to Central Huron budget deliberations.

One of the points made by Williams was that the United Way is very familiar with the needs of the communities and agencies it serves.

He says that allows it to direct funding to the unique and specific needs of each community and makes sure the money is going where it's needed most.
